The crow trap
Three very different women come together to complete an environmental survey. Three women who, in some way or another, know the meaning of betrayal....For team leader Rachael Lambert the project is the perfect opportunity to rebuild her confidence after a double-betrayal by her lover and boss, Peter Kemp. Botanist Anne Preece, on the other hand, sees it as a chance to indulge in a little deception of her own. And then there is Grace Fulwell, a strange, uncommunicative young woman with plenty of her own secrets to hide... When Rachael arrives at the cottage, however, she is horrified to discover the body of her friend Bella Furness. Bella, it appears, has committed suicide--a verdict Rachael finds impossible to accept. Only when the next death occurs does a fourth woman enter the picture--the unconventional Detective Inspector Vera Stanhope, who must piece together the truth from these women's tangled lives in The Crow Trap . In a randomized trial of bortezomib, cyclophosphamide, and dexamethasone as compared with the same therapy plus daratumumab, patients with light-chain amyloidosis who received daratumumab had a higher frequency of hematologic complete response than those who did not (53.3% vs. 18.1%). Deaths were most commonly due to cardiac failure.

The existing research on fresh food supply chains (FFSC) sustainability consisting of fur fundamental pillars, namely green (G), resilient (R), agile (A), and sustainability (S) (hereafter GRAS), is explored sparsely and needs thorough investigation. Further, conceptualization and mutual interactions among GRAS enablers that can help perpetuate sustainable supply chains (SSC) still need to be addressed. This study proposes a methodological framework to evaluate the SCS from the perspective of GRAS enablers with an application for the Indian FFSC. A mixed-method sequential approach was used with interviews followed by integrated fuzzy interpretive structural modelling—decision-making trial and evaluation laboratory (FISM-DEMATEL) techniques. The study recognizes twenty supply chain sustainability (SCS) enablers through an extensive literature review and discussions with the expert group. The research discloses that the firms' ‘organization culture’ acts as the most powerful driver in achieving sustainability in FFSC, followed by the firms’ ‘environmental certification program’ and ‘financial strength.’ This investigation helps the managers/policymakers of the Indian FFSC to ascertain and comprehend the most significant SCS enablers to achieve sustainability in the supply chain (SC). The causation of SCS enablers supports the managers in systematically focusing on the most significant enablers and working towards their successful implementation. According to our knowledge, this is the first scholarly work that establishes hierarchies and interrelationships among GRAS enablers, thereby providing a holistic picture to decision-makers while adapting such practices.

Resilience in global supply chains: analysis of responses, recovery actions and strategic changes triggered by major disruptions
2023
Purpose
Are major and frequent disruptions transforming global supply chains? This study aims to investigate how multinational companies (MNCs) are responding to the phenomenon of accumulated major disruptions in recent years and plausible new paradigm of unstable conditions and environmental uncertainty from a supply chain resilience (SCRES) perspective.
Design/methodology/approach
Following an inductive interpretivist approach based on interpretive phenomenology, this study gathers insights from ten MNCs supply chain managers and international consultants who participated as key informants via semi-structured interviews, sharing their experience of the phenomenon. Additionally, secondary sources such as press releases, media articles and industry reports were used for data collection.
Findings
Findings include five categories of recovery actions, i.e. levelling, rationing, buffering, bridging and boundary redefining, key strategic changes in competitive priorities, internal organisation and coordination structures, and a hierarchy between SCRES characteristics, integrated in an empirically derived conceptual framework connecting these constructs. This contributes to middle-range theories within SCRES body of knowledge. The authors also identify a set of areas for future SCRES research.
Practical implications
Findings can support MNCs’ supply chain professionals in designing and managing resilient global supply chains, based on learnings from the recent highly disruptive environment, particularly, regarding recovery actions and resilience-building strategic changes contributing to agility and robustness in global supply chains.
Originality/value
Non-positivist interpretive and inductive works are scarce in SCRES research. By adopting this novel approach for this field, the authors broadened the categorisation of responses used in previous works and identified prominent strategic changes and SCRES characteristics and relations among constructs, thus bringing conceptual clarity to SCRES research within the context of the study.

Systemic light chain amyloidosis (AL) is a life-threatening disease caused by aggregation and deposition of monoclonal immunoglobulin light chains (LC) in target organs. Severity of heart involvement is the most important factor determining prognosis. Here, we report the 4.0 Å resolution cryo-electron microscopy map and molecular model of amyloid fibrils extracted from the heart of an AL amyloidosis patient with severe amyloid cardiomyopathy. The helical fibrils are composed of a single protofilament, showing typical 4.9 Å stacking and cross-β architecture. Purpose – This paper provides a robust and structured literature review on supply chain resilience (SCRES), the supply chain’s ability to be prepared for unexpected risk events, responding and recovering quickly to potential disruptions to return to its original situation or grow by moving to a new, more desirable state. The purpose of this paper is to analyze the extant research through focussed questions and provide an insightful framework with propositions to guide further publications and identify future research needs. Design/methodology/approach – The findings underlie a systematic literature review methodology requiring a robust method of literature analysis. The sand cone model is adopted to develop a comprehensive SCRES framework. Findings – The literature review reveals a strong need for an overarching SCRES definition and a clear terminology for its building elements. It indicates that most research has been qualitative and lacks in assessing and measuring SCRES performance. Originality/value – This paper contributes a structured overview of 67 peer-reviewed articles from 2003 to 2013 on an emerging area of supply chain research. The review formulates an overarching definition of SCRES, groups and synthesizes the various SCRES elements into proactive and reactive strategies for the ex-ante/ex-post disruption stage and illustrates SCRES measurement through performance metrics. It provides a comprehensive SCRES framework with propositions and indicates gaps in the literature to target for further development.
